Amritsar weather in May

In May, Amritsar has daytime highs averaging 39 °C, nights around 23 °C, with 5.9 wet days. Figures are 1991–2020 climate normals.

How May develops

Averages for the first, middle and last part of the month, from daily 1991–2020 normals. Chance of rain is the share of years in which that calendar day recorded more than 1 mm.

Days Avg high Avg low Chance of rain
1–10 May 37.5 °C 21.5 °C 21 %
11–20 May 38.7 °C 23.1 °C 17 %
21–31 May 39.8 °C 24.3 °C 20 %

QuestionsMay in Amritsar, answered

How warm is Amritsar in May?

Daily highs average 39 °C and nights fall to about 23 °C, a spread of 16 °C between afternoon and dawn. That makes May the 2nd warmest month of the year here.

Does it rain much in Amritsar in May?

May averages 22 mm of rain, spread over about 6 of the 31 days — 19 % of the month. Cloud cover averages 29 % of the sky.

How long are the days in May?

Amritsar averages 14 hours between sunrise and sunset in May. Day length is computed from latitude and date, so it is exact rather than modelled — but it says nothing about how much of that time is sunny.
